comprising dotted Swiss The bisque socket head
doll has elongated facial modelling, brown glass
inset eyes, painted lashes, feathered brows,
accented nostrils and eye corners, slightly
parted lips, four porcelain teeth, pierced ears,
brunette mohair wig, composition and wooden ball-
jointed body. The doll wears antique costume of
parlour maid, comprising dotted Swiss dress with
lace trim, black silk velvet-edged apron with
double pockets, lace cap, undergarments, woven
stockings, white leather shoes and carries little
bisque doll in her pocket. Signed "204". Bahr and
Proschild, circa 1890. 11" (28 cm). Repaired.
